Site cl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, brush, and other vegetation from a property to prepare it for development, landscaping, or other projects. These services typically include land grading, debris removal, stump grinding, and brush clearing to create a clean, level, and accessible space. The work is designed to eliminate obstacles that could interfere with construction, planting, or property improvement efforts, ensuring the land is ready for its intended use.

One of the primary issues site clearing services address is overgrown or unmanaged vegetation that can hinder construction or landscaping plans. Excess brush, fallen trees, or uneven terrain can pose safety hazards, obstruct views, or make future work more difficult and costly. Clearing a property can also reduce the risk of pests or fire hazards associated with unmanaged brush, while providing a safe and open area for building or recreational purposes.

Properties that typically utilize site clearing services include residential lots, commercial developments, industrial sites, and agricultural land. Residential properties may require clearing before new construction or landscaping projects. Commercial and industrial sites often need extensive clearing to prepare for building foundations, parking lots, or infrastructure installation. Agricultural lands may be cleared to facilitate planting or to manage overgrown fields, making the land more functional and accessible.

The overview below groups typical Site Clearing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Duluth,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Acre Costs - Site clearing services typically range from $1,200 to $4,500 per acre, depending on terrain and vegetation. For example, clearing a half-acre lot might cost around $600 to $2,250. Costs can vary based on the size and complexity of the project.

Per Square Foot Prices - Clearing costs usually fall between $0.10 and $0.50 per square foot. For instance, clearing a 10,000-square-foot lot could cost approximately $1,000 to $5,000. Larger or more difficult sites tend to increase the overall expense.

Tree and Brush Removal - Removing trees and dense brush can add to the overall costs, often ranging from $200 to $1,000 per tree. The price varies based on tree size, location, and accessibility for equipment.

Additional Services - Services such as stump grinding or debris hauling may be charged separately, typically costing between $150 and $500. These extras can impact the total project cost depending on the scope of work need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
